Package: devscripts
Version: 2.11.4
User: [email protected]
Usertags: deb-reversion
According to the manual page, -k argument "must be in quotes if it is
more than one (shell) word." I'm not sure whether this a comment on how
user's shell splits arguments or how deb-reversion splits them, but in
either case quoting doesn't help:
$ deb-reversion -k 'echo hello world' devscripts_2.11.4_i386.deb
/usr/bin/deb-reversion: eval: line 77: unexpected EOF while looking for
matching `''
$ deb-reversion -k "'echo hello world'" devscripts_2.11.4_i386.deb
/usr/bin/deb-reversion: eval: line 77: unexpected EOF while looking for
matching `''
$ deb-reversion -k '"echo hello world"' devscripts_2.11.4_i386.deb
/usr/bin/deb-reversion: eval: line 77: unexpected EOF while looking for
matching `''

Changes:
devscripts (2.11.5) unstable; urgency=low
.
[ Adam D. Barratt ]
* deb-reversion:
+ Re-fix handling of multi-word hooks. (Closes: #660782).
This was originally fixed in 2.9.14 but accidentally broken again in
2.9.26.
+ Correctly handle cases where a changelog file was not found, possibly
because of the use of symlinks. (Closes: #660788)
.
[ Jakub Wilk ]
* deb-reversion: Simplify option parsing, also allowing simpler quoting of
arguments.
.
[ James McCoy ]
* dd-list: Fix correlation of given package name when it does not match the
source package name. (Closes: #655854)
* dcmd: Escape directory name so it doesn't interfere with sed command.
(Closes: #649227)
* debsnap: Check whether architectures have been specified. (Closes:
#655932)
* pts-subscribe: Correct URL to Developer's Reference. (Closes: #661337)
* mk-build-deps: Use the most recent version when multiple package versions
are available. (Closes: #633143)
.
[ Benjamin Drung ]
* edit-patch:
+ Do not unapply quilt patches. Thanks to Michael Hall for
the patch. (Closes: #662689, LP: #947180)
+ Remove trailing .sh when checking if the script is being run as
edit-patch
or add-patch. Thanks to Michael Hall for the patch. (LP: #953857)
* Bump Standard-Version to 3.9.3 (no changes needed).
